Abstract
Given the growing need for rehabilitation services, driven by consequences of COVID-19 pandemic, the rise in chronic diseases, injuries, and postoperative complications, the importance of the effective rehabilitation environment is increasing. Modern approaches to rehabilitation and high-tech medical equipment require the creation of the healing architectural environment and flexible architectural and planning solutions.
Purpose: The aim of this study is to identify universal principles and trends in the design of rehabilitation centers that are applicable in Western Siberia.
Methodology/approach: This study employs a graphical and comparative analysis of urban planning layouts and functional and spatial planning solutions. The study is based on examination of rehabilitation centers across three main approaches: domestic, European, and Asian to the design of medical facilities.
Research findings: The study identifies characteristics and patterns of architectural solutions for each approach, which can be applied to the design of future healthcare facilities. Special attention is paid to the integration of facilities into the natural and urban environment with a view to create a sustainable, accessible, and safe architectural environment that promotes recovery and social adaptation of patients. The analysis highlights the need to adapt international experience to domestic design practices for the development of rehabilitation centers in Western Siberia.
